Expert Verdict

Susceptible to oxidation due to its polyunsaturated (two double bonds) structure, which can generate off-odors and potential skin irritants upon degradation; requires antioxidant stabilization in formulations. Methanol ester of linoleic acid; formula CH₃(CH₂)₃(CH₂CH=CH)₂(CH₂)₇CO₂CH₃; provides skin-softening effects and is used in perfumery as a natural-effect enhancer
